Transaction

084bb7f33c647e67fac835871e571ba30cf2d704e8734d39b51f73ac9b75b449

Summary

In Block270351
TimeSat, 15 Jul 2023 18:01:00 UTC
Total Input2509.44250014 Nebula
Total Output2509.44240694 Nebula
Fees0.0000932 Nebula

Details

Raw Transaction